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Sanquhar to Godstone start from as little as £51.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Sanquhar to Godstone start from £119.40 one way, or £170.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Sanquhar to Godstone are available for £207.00 one way, or £414.00 return

Facilities at Sanquhar Train Station

If you're planning to travel from Sanquhar, it's important to know what to expect in terms of facilities. Unfortunately, you won't find a ticket office or ticket machines here, but you can collect tickets online. The station does, however, provide smartcard validators and an induction loop for those requiring these facilities. While staff assistance is not available, there are customer help points for inquiries.

While Sanquhar doesn't offer waiting rooms or refreshment facilities, there is a designated seating area, ensuring you can wait comfortably for your train. Despite having limited facilities, what the station lacks in services, it makes up for in easy access, with ramps to both platforms. Additionally, parking is free but limited to four spaces, including one accessible spot for Blue Badge holders.

Facilities and Amenities

While compact, Godstone station provides essential facilities that cater to the needs of its travelers. Though there’s no ticket office, ticket machines are available and fully equipped to handle ticket collections and sales, including those with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. For those needing assistance, Godstone features a help point system on its platforms and has induction loops for those with hearing impairments.

In terms of accessibility, Godstone is classified as a Category B3 station. There is step-free access in certain areas via a long and somewhat steep ramp, providing access to platform 2. Unfortunately, platform 1 requires the use of steps, and passengers requiring assistance are encouraged to make arrangements beforehand. Although there isn’t staff available at Godstone, helpful on-board staff is ready to assist passengers with boarding where needed. Other facilities include a seating area, payphones, as well as limited bicycle storage with CCTV for security.
